Hire The Right Graphic Designer

The right graphic designer can do wonders for your online company. First you need to know what you want, and how to find the best graphic designer who can meet your expectations.

Not sure if you need a graphic designer? A graphic web designer is someone who is an expert at brining together color, illustrations, photography, typography and paper in order to deliver your business message to clients in an eye-catching way. This message may be needed for business cards, posters, brochures, logos, books, invitations, etc.

If you don’t know the first thing about using graphics to improve the look of your business or boost originality, seeking the expertise of a graphic designer is something you should seriously consider.

The following is what you need to think about if you decide to hire a graphic designer:

Know what you want – Do you need a logo to help create presence and be remembered by visitors? Do you require business cards? Are you looking to promote a new product or service on your website? When you know what you want, it will be easier for you to find the right graphic designer who can achieve your aim.

Find a designer – If you are not sure where to look for a graphic designer, begin by conducting an online search for designers located in your region. It’s also a good idea to talk to friends and colleagues for recommendations and ideas.

Portfolio – One of the best ways to discover if you have found the right graphic designer is to check out some of their past projects. Ask to see their portfolio and carefully decide from their previous graphic design products, if their skills will help you achieve your aim.

Project description – Relay your project ideas to the graphic web designer and see what they think. They will likely have plenty of questions, so make sure you answer them with as much clarity as you can provide. It is also a good idea to find samples of logos, business cards, etc. that you like, and provide them.

During this time when you are discussing the project with the designer, you will get a taste of their personality and expertise, allowing you to see if you can build a good business relationship with them.

Budget - Keep in mind that good graphic designers don’t come cheap. It takes a respectable amount of time, energy and work for them to create the original designs and graphics you are looking for. Therefore, be prepared for a high price tag depending on the size of your business, and the amount of work you are commissioning them for.

Moreover, understand that the more detail you want to the graphic the more it will cost you. For instance, logos tend to be the most time consuming and usually command the highest prices. Price is also linked to size and color. Black and white, or the use of two colors, is far cheaper than asking for graphics that include a full spectrum of color. Ask for your designer to give you a quote based on your project description so you can estimate the cost.

Time to hire – once you find the graphics designer you like, it’s time to hire them for the job. However, before you O.K. the project, make sure you draw up a contract that includes all of the details of the job that is to be done. The contract should include a completion schedule and printing estimate. Be prepared to pay for half of the total fee up front and the rest when the project is successfully completed to your liking.

Stay in touch – during the duration of the project, make sure you keep in contact with the graphic designer to make sure they are on the right track. Stay in contact until the project is a done deal.

The bottom line is the right graphic designer is someone you can work well with. They should have total understanding of what you want, and be committed to helping you achieve your goal.
